Phase IV

Saul Bass's only feature. The ants are shot like a nature documentary and it is deeply strange.

The only feature Saul Bass directed, and it looks like nothing else because he was a title designer.

Ants in the Arizona desert achieve a collective intelligence after a cosmic event. Two scientists in a sealed dome try to communicate with them.

Ken Middleham shot the insect sequences as genuine macro documentary, with real ants performing real behaviours, and Bass cuts them together as though the ants have a plot, which they do. There is no anthropomorphism and no animation.

The dome, the heat, the geometric towers the ants build, and the yellow light are pure design intelligence applied to a science fiction premise.

Paramount removed the original ending, a four-minute abstract sequence, and it was believed lost until a print turned up in 2012. Find a version that has it.

Almost nobody saw it. Almost everybody who has cites it.
